2. The Key to Success Corporate commitment is the key ingredient to a successful energy and environmental management program. Most organizations most likely will need to dramatically change its culture in order to achieve and sustain meaningful results from an energy and environmental program. To create change, there must be COMMITMENT.
3. How do you convince senior executives that energy and environmental management is worthy of corporate commitment? Just follow the 5 essential steps described in this presentation...
4. Essential Steps to establish Corporate Commitment Define the magnitude of annual energy & environmental related expenditures Set goals and objectives Allocate adequate resources to manage energy & environment Document policies and procedures Establish financial parameters for capital investment in energy and environmental management projects
5. 1. Define the Magnitude of Annual Energy & Environmental Related Expenditures You want to define the size of the “energy and environment business” within your organization. How much does the company spend annually on electricity, natural gas, fuel etc.? What is the percentage of this expenditure relative to sales or controllable operating costs? How much money is spent annually maintaining energy assets such as boilers, chillers, rooftops, lighting etc.? How much money is spent annually on capital upgrades or replacement of these same systems? How much labour time is already devoted to management energy and energy assets ?
6. 2. Set Goals and Objectives Establish concrete targets, objectives and timelines for the energy and environmental management program. Goals & objectives: reduced operating costs increased productivity increased profitability reduced environmental footprint improved employee awareness improved customer image Goals & objectives should contribute towards the long-term sustainability of the organization
7. 3. Allocate Adequate Resources to Manage Energy and Environment A good rule of thumb would be to allocate 3 to 5% of the annual energy and environment related expenditure towards the program. Appoint an Energy Manager or Champion as well as internal and/or external resources dedicated to assisting in procurement, accounting and energy efficiency.
8. 4. Document Policies and Procedures Provides consistency and standardization – creates a seamless process to follow. Policies and procedures will help guide the overall energy and environmental management program towards achieving its goals and objectives.
9. 5. Establish Financial Parameters for Capital Investment Must define if and to what extent capital will be made available to fund energy and environmental projects. Can’t spend money if there is no commitment to fund. These terms must be understood before any project development work is initiated.
10. Last words… Some Last Words… Present your business case to senior executives and prove the importance of corporate commitment towards energy and environment within your organization Establishing corporate commitment will increase the probability of successfully implementing an energy and environmental management program
